Output d17db3ae5ede8cca49e588370084f60ac0dcbb2d04a7c07e37e9ee4810258dba:22

value
82917987266
script pubkey
OP_0 OP_PUSHBYTES_20 0b50c84e88abeb5a52fe5d28574046bba9dbc64e
address
tb1qpdgvsn5g404455h7t559wszxhw5ah3jwuae57w
transaction
d17db3ae5ede8cca49e588370084f60ac0dcbb2d04a7c07e37e9ee4810258dba
confirmations
10070
spent
true